Kraft Heinz certainly isn't covering itself in glory. Like a bad smell coming from your shoe.

But on the other hand, it isn't in any immediate danger. The dividend seems covered currently and their pricing can probably keep up with inflation. So if you were able to be comfortable considering it a 6.5% inflation protected perpetual bond, it's not a bad place to have the firm's money. Emphasis on "if", but the right answer might just be "throw it in the corner and ignore it".

Unless a whopping great elephant comes along and you could redeploy the capital better, of course. For now it's still "too much capital, too few opportunities".
